What is Urine Specific Gravity?

Urine specific gravity (USG) is a measure of the concentration of dissolved solids in your urine. It essentially tells us how much "stuff" – like salts, minerals, and waste products – is dissolved in your urine compared to pure water. A higher specific gravity indicates more concentrated urine, while a lower specific gravity means more diluted urine. Understanding urine specific gravity is crucial for evaluating kidney function and overall hydration status.

Why is Urine Specific Gravity Important?

Measuring urine specific gravity is a simple yet powerful diagnostic tool used by healthcare professionals to assess several aspects of health, including:

  • Hydration Status: USG is a primary indicator of hydration. Dehydration leads to higher USG as the kidneys try to conserve water. Conversely, overhydration results in lower USG.
  • Kidney Function: The kidneys play a vital role in regulating fluid and electrolyte balance. Abnormal USG can indicate impaired kidney function, suggesting problems with concentrating or diluting urine.
  • Diabetes: High USG can be a sign of uncontrolled diabetes, where the kidneys excrete excess glucose, leading to increased urine concentration.
  • Dehydration: As mentioned earlier, concentrated urine (high USG) is a clear sign of dehydration. This can be caused by various factors, including insufficient fluid intake, excessive sweating, or diarrhea.
  • Other Medical Conditions: Specific gravity measurements can aid in the diagnosis of other conditions such as kidney disease, heart failure, and liver disease. Abnormal USG often warrants further investigation.

How is Urine Specific Gravity Measured?

Urine specific gravity is typically measured using one of the following methods:

  • Refractometer: This handheld device uses the principle of light refraction to measure the concentration of dissolved solids. It provides a quick and accurate reading.
  • Urinometer: A urinometer is a float-type device placed in a urine sample. The point where it floats indicates the specific gravity. This method is less accurate than a refractometer.
  • Dipstick Test: Some reagent strips can estimate specific gravity, although they are less precise than refractometers or urinometers. They are often used as a quick screening tool.

Normal Urine Specific Gravity Range

The normal range for urine specific gravity typically falls between 1.005 and 1.030. However, this range can vary slightly depending on the individual's hydration status, diet, and overall health. Factors influencing USG include:

  • Fluid Intake: Higher fluid intake generally results in lower USG.
  • Diet: A diet high in sodium or protein can increase USG.
  • Medications: Certain medications can affect urine concentration.
  • Physical Activity: Sweating during exercise can concentrate urine, leading to a higher USG.

What do Abnormal Urine Specific Gravity Readings Indicate?

Deviations from the normal range can indicate potential health issues:

  • High Specific Gravity (above 1.030): This often points towards dehydration, uncontrolled diabetes, kidney disease, or congestive heart failure.
  • Low Specific Gravity (below 1.005): This frequently suggests overhydration, diabetes insipidus (a condition affecting the body's ability to regulate fluid balance), or chronic kidney disease.

Frequently Asked Questions (FAQs)

Q: How can I improve my urine specific gravity if it's too high?

A: If your USG is high, it likely indicates dehydration. Increase your fluid intake by drinking more water, juice, or electrolyte solutions. Consult a healthcare professional to rule out any underlying medical conditions.

Q: Can I test my urine specific gravity at home?

A: You can purchase home urine specific gravity test strips or a refractometer. However, these should be seen as preliminary tests, and any abnormal results should be followed up with a medical professional for proper diagnosis.

Q: What other tests are done along with a urine specific gravity test?

A: Urine specific gravity is often part of a more comprehensive urinalysis which may include a microscopic examination of urine sediment, a chemical analysis to check for substances like glucose and protein, and a measurement of urine pH. Blood tests may also be performed to assess kidney function or identify underlying medical issues.
